Estimate total loan cost.

When you use a personal loan calculator with amortization, you can estimate the total cost of your loan before you apply for it. This includes the amount of interest you will pay over the life of the loan, as well as any fees or charges associated with the loan.

To estimate the total loan cost, simply enter the following information into the calculator:

  • The amount of money you want to borrow
  • The interest rate on the loan
  • The length of the loan in months

Once you have entered this information, the calculator will show you the following:

  • Your monthly payment amount
  • The total amount of interest you will pay over the life of the loan
  • The total cost of the loan, including interest and fees

Knowing the total cost of the loan before you apply for it can help you make an informed decision about whether or not to take out the loan. It can also help you compare different loan options to find the one that is right for you.

Compare different loan options.

Once you have a good estimate of the total cost of a personal loan, you can start to compare different loan options to find the one that is right for you. There are a few things to consider when comparing loan options:

  • Interest rate: The interest rate is the most important factor to consider when comparing loan options. The higher the interest rate, the more you will pay in interest over the life of the loan.
  • Loan terms: The loan terms include the length of the loan and the repayment schedule. You should choose a loan term that you can afford and that meets your needs.
  • Fees: Some personal loans have fees associated with them, such as origination fees, prepayment fees, and late fees. Be sure to compare the fees of different loan options before you choose a loan.
  • Lender reputation: It is important to choose a lender that is reputable and has a good track record. You can read reviews of different lenders online or ask your friends and family for recommendations.

Once you have considered all of these factors, you can start to narrow down your choices and choose the personal loan option that is right for you.

Avoid overborrowing.

One of the biggest benefits of using a personal loan calculator with amortization is that it can help you avoid overborrowing. Overborrowing occurs when you take out a loan for more money than you can afford to repay. This can lead to financial problems, such as missed payments, high interest rates, and even bankruptcy.

By using a personal loan calculator with amortization, you can see how different loan amounts will affect your monthly payments and the total cost of your loan. This information can help you choose a loan amount that you can afford to repay.

Here are some tips for avoiding overborrowing with a personal loan calculator with amortization:

  • Be honest about your financial situation: When you use the calculator, be honest about your income, expenses, and debts. This will help you get an accurate estimate of how much you can afford to borrow.
  • Choose a loan amount that you can afford to repay: Don’t borrow more money than you can afford to repay each month. This will help you avoid missed payments and high interest rates.
  • Consider your future financial goals: Before you take out a personal loan, consider your future financial goals. Do you plan to buy a house or a car? Do you want to save for retirement? Make sure that the loan payments won’t interfere with your ability to achieve your future financial goals.
